编程语法为什么重要呢

编程语法为什么重要呢

编程语法的重要性体现在1、提高代码的可读性、2、确保程序的正确执行。对于其中的第一点,提高代码的可读性,这意味着程序员之间可以更容易地分享和理解彼此的代码,从而加快开发过程,并降低后期维护的复杂度和成本。良好的编程习惯和统一的代码风格对于团队协作尤为重要,因为它们确保了所有成员都能快速阅读和理解代码,不仅对当前项目成员,对于后续可能接手项目的新成员也同样重要。

一、代码可读性的重要性

在软件开发的世界里,代码的可读性占据了非常重要的地位。代码不仅是给机器看的,更是给人看的。当开发者遵守统一的编程语法规则时,代码的可读性自然就会提高。这不仅有助于团队成员之间的相互理解和协作,还能大大缩班新成员的上手时间。良好的可读性意味着代码结构清晰、逻辑明了,即便是在面对复杂的逻辑和算法时,也可以快速定位和理解代码的功能及其工作原理。

二、正确执行的保证

编程语法规则的遵守是确保程序能够正确执行的前提。错误的语法不仅会导致程序运行失败,还可能引发难以预料的错误。因此,严格遵守编程语法规则显得尤为重要。正确的语法有助于编译器或解释器准确理解程序员的意图,从而生成正确的执行指令。

三、代码维护的简化

代码的维护工作占据了软件生命周期中的大部分时间和资源。遵守良好的编程语法规则可以极大地简化维护工作。当代码遵循清晰且一致的风格时,发现并修复错误变得更加容易。同样,当需要添加新的功能或对现有功能进行修改时,清晰的代码结构可以让开发者快速定位到需要改动的部分。

四、促进跨语言学习

掌握一门编程语言的语法规则有助于学习其他编程语言。尽管不同的编程语言在语法上可能存在差异,但大多数语言还是遵循一些基本的编程原则和模式。具备良好的语法基础,可以使程序员在学习新语言时更加得心应手,能够快速地适应新的编程环境。

五、提高编程效率

遵循语法规则还可以提高编程效率。编写符合语法规则的代码可以减少调试和测试的时间,因为这样的代码更容易理解和验证。此外,许多现代IDE(集成开发环境)提供了语法高亮、代码补全和错误提示等功能,这些功能都需要代码遵循正确的语法规则才能正确工作。利用这些工具,可以进一步提高编程的效率和质量。

总的来说,编程语法的重要性不仅体现在提高代码的可读性和确保程序正确执行这两个方面,还在于它对于代码维护的简化、促进跨语言学习和提高编程效率等方面的积极影响。因此,无论是对于初学者还是经验丰富的开发者,都应该重视编程语法的学习和应用。

相关问答FAQs:

为什么编程语法重要?

编程语法是编程的基础,它规定了代码的书写规则和格式。正确的编程语法可以确保代码的可读性和可维护性,并减少出错的可能性。只有掌握了正确的编程语法,才能编写出高效、健壮的程序。下面是编程语法重要的几个原因:

1. 代码的可读性:编程语法规定了如何组织、命名和注释代码,使代码更易于阅读和理解。良好的编程语法能够使其他人轻松理解你的代码,并能够快速修改和维护。

2. 代码的易于调试:有了正确的编程语法,你可以轻松地找出代码中的错误和问题,并对其进行调试。编程语法定义了代码应该如何被解析和执行,这帮助你更容易地追踪和修复错误。

3. 代码的可维护性:当你的代码库逐渐变大时,良好的编程语法能够帮助你更好地组织和维护代码。规范的编程语法可以保持代码的一致性,并使代码易于扩展和修改。

4. 代码的可移植性:编程语言的语法规则决定了代码的可移植性。如果你的代码符合某种标准的编程语法,那么在不同的平台和环境中都可以运行。这使得你可以更轻松地迁移和共享代码。

5. 代码的安全性:编程语法可以帮助你避免一些常见的安全漏洞。例如,一些编程语言要求在使用动态内存时进行内存管理,这可以避免内存泄漏和缓冲区溢出等安全问题。

总之,编程语法是编程的基础,掌握正确的编程语法对于编写高质量的代码至关重要。无论是初学者还是专业程序员,都应该始终注重编程语法的学习和实践。

文章标题:编程语法为什么重要呢,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/2072301

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
不及物动词的头像不及物动词
上一篇 2024年5月12日
下一篇 2024年5月12日

相关推荐

  • 有哪些好用的HR管理软件?2024年最顶级的8款

    本文介绍了以下8款工具:Moka、薪人薪事、大易Dayee、DingTalk、GoCo、Bullhorn、Workday、UKG Pro。 很多企业在面临如何高效地管理招聘、薪酬和员工绩效时,都会遇到操作繁琐、数据难以整合等痛点。一个好的HR管理软件不仅能简化这些流程,还能显著提高工作效率和员工满意…

    2024年8月4日
    600
  • 最好用的10款人力资源SAAS软件盘点

    本文将介绍以下10款工具:Moka、北森云计算、智能人事、蓝凌OA、人瑞人才、Rippling、Sage HR、Deel、Gusto、TriNet。 在管理人力资源时,选择正确的工具至关重要。市场上的众多SAAS软件选项可能会让你感到不知所措,特别是在试图找到能够提升团队效率和员工满意度的解决方案时…

    2024年8月3日
    400
  • 简化HR工作:9款顶级软件工具评测

    文章将介绍以下9款人力资源管理工具:Moka、HiHR、百应HR、天助网、华天动力HRM、Calabrio ONE、Clockify、WorkForce Software、BambooHR。 在现代企业管理中,人力资源部门的效率直接影响到整个组织的运营效能。一款好用且靠谱的人力资源管理软件不仅可以帮…

    2024年8月3日
    800
  • 有哪些好用靠谱的人力资源管理软件推荐?使用最广泛的11款

    文章介绍了11款人力资源管理工具:Moka、友人才、北森HRSaaS、同鑫eHR、i人事、红海eHR、BambooHR、Skuad、Hibob、OrangeHRM、Verint。 在选择人力资源管理软件时,选错不仅浪费时间和金钱,还会影响团队的工作效率和员工满意度。本文总结了11款使用最广泛、口碑最…

    2024年8月3日
    600
  • 管理类项目应用领域有哪些

    管理类项目应用领域广泛且多样,涵盖了各个行业和领域。首先,科技行业,例如软件开发、网络安全、人工智能等,都需要用到项目管理的知识和技能。其次,建筑行业,包括建筑设计、施工、装修等,都需要进行项目管理。再者,教育行业,包括学校管理、课程设计、教学改革等,也需要进行项目管理。另外,医疗行业,如医院管理、…

    2024年8月3日
    600

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部